America’s Favorite Farmers Markets
The results are in for the American Farmland Trust’s America’s Favorite Farmers Markets contest. Thousands of votes were cast. You can see a list of the top twenty here. The winners for this year are: Large Davis Farmers Market Davis, CA Votes: 3032 Medium Williamsburg Farmers Market Williamsburg, VA Votes: 725 Small Collingswood Farmers Market Collingswood, NJ Votes: 1027

No Request For Soybean Checkoff Referendum
It looks like there was very little interest on the part of soybean growers to request a new referendum according to the results of the latest opportunity as announced by USDA. USDA received only 759 request for referendum forms at county Farm Service Agency Offices, which reflects approximately one tenth of one percent of all eligible U.S. soybean farmers. Had …
